The economy nearing the end of the first quarter

It's complicated out there.

This certainly describes the state of the economy and the position of the promotional products industry.

For example: Consumer inflation remains stubbornly above the Federal Reserve's 2% annual increase range and was higher than expected in February. Still, it's below the wild highs of recent years and so much progress has been made that the Fed says it will cut interest rates several times in 2024, which could help boost economic activity – a potential boon for the promo.

Meanwhile, some see headwinds from unemployment and consumer spending, but hiring remained relatively strong and U.S. gross domestic product growth forecasts have brightened. Although the fourth quarter of 2023 was essentially flat in terms of promo distributor sales, preliminary feedback earlier in the year suggests that 2024 is off to a better start.

These statistics fill in the details to provide an informed perspective.

3.2%
Ascension into the Consumer price index in February 2024 compared to February 2023. The CPI is a measure of inflationMeasuring what consumers pay. (US Department of Labor)
3.8%
Year-on-year increase in February in “Core CPI” which Volatile prices for food and energy are excluded.(US Department of Labor)
1.6%
The rise of the Producer price index this February compared to the same month last year. That was the Steepest annual increase since September 2023. The PPI essentially measures what is paid on wholesale level.(US Department of Labor)

symbol275,000
Number Non-agricultural jobs have been added to the US labor market in February better than the downwardly revised presentation of 229,000 in January. (US Department of Labor)
SymbolsThe industries of Healthcare (67,000 jobs), Government (52,000) and Food/drinking areas (42,000) accounted for the most employment gains in February. (US Department of Labor)
3.9%
The US unemployment rate End of February. That was a 0.2 Increase of percentage points compared to the previous month. (US Department of Labor)
6.5 million
The number of listed Unemployed people in the USA in February an increase compared to the previous year of approximately 500,000, or 8.3%.(US Department of Labor)
1.7 million
The number of people among the US unemployed who report permanent job loss in February 2024. That was over 174,000or 11.2% percent, as of January 2024. (U.S. Department of Labor)
